HINES v. HINES

No. 12253.

624 S.W.2d 888 (1981)

Ralph L. HINES, Plaintiff-Appellant, v. Edna A. HINES, Defendant-Respondent.

Missouri Court of Appeals, Southern District, Division Two.

November 12, 1981.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

John A. Watkins, Greenfield, for plaintiff-appellant.

Robert L. Payne, Greenfield, for defendant-respondent.


PREWITT, Presiding Judge.

Plaintiff sought partition of real estate owned by him and defendant, as tenants in common. Pursuant to court order the sheriff conducted a sale of the property and defendant, at $45,000, was the high bidder. Defendant could not "come up with the amount" of her bid and the sale was readvertised and the property sold for $40,100. By motion the sheriff sought judgment against defendant for $4,900.
